Output d76b16c69dc6092b22f321b23c48bfe6cc059a7fff2a2357027b4e76da8b8fda:1

value
1085642
script pubkey
OP_0 OP_PUSHBYTES_20 52d3bace1cc4d11c84efebaaaf37ef37d9f9f3d3
address
bc1q2tfm4nsucng3ep80aw427dl0xlvlnu7nt977wk
transaction
d76b16c69dc6092b22f321b23c48bfe6cc059a7fff2a2357027b4e76da8b8fda
confirmations
117658
spent
true